ProShares Short MidCap400
ETF Overview
Overview
ProShares Short MidCap400 (MYY) seeks daily investment results, before fees and expenses, that correspond to the inverse (-1x) of the daily performance of the S&P MidCap 400 Index. It is designed for sophisticated investors seeking to profit from a short-term decline in mid-cap stocks.
Reputation and Reliability
ProShares is a well-known issuer specializing in leveraged and inverse ETFs, with a reputation for innovation and offering a wide range of specialized investment products.
Management Expertise
ProShares' management team has extensive experience in managing complex ETF strategies, including inverse and leveraged funds.
Investment Objective
Goal
To provide daily investment results that correspond to the inverse (-1x) of the daily performance of the S&P MidCap 400 Index.
Investment Approach and Strategy
Strategy: The ETF employs a strategy of using swaps, futures contracts, and other derivatives to achieve its inverse exposure to the S&P MidCap 400 Index on a daily basis.
Composition The ETF primarily holds derivative instruments designed to provide inverse exposure. It does not directly hold stocks.

Financial Performance
Historical Performance: Historical performance will inversely correlate with the S&P MidCap 400 Index. Performance can fluctuate significantly, and is best understood over very short timeframes due to compounding effects in daily resets.
Benchmark Comparison: The ETF's performance should be inversely correlated to the S&P MidCap 400 Index on a daily basis. However, over longer periods, the effects of daily compounding can lead to significant deviations.

Risk Analysis
Volatility
The ETF is highly volatile due to its inverse and daily resetting nature. It is designed for short-term trading and is not suitable for long-term investment.
Market Risk
The ETF is subject to market risk, particularly the risk associated with mid-cap stocks. The inverse nature of the ETF means that it will lose value if the S&P MidCap 400 Index rises.

Summary
ProShares Short MidCap400 (MYY) is an inverse ETF designed to deliver the opposite of the daily performance of the S&P MidCap 400 Index. It is a niche product suited for sophisticated investors seeking to profit from short-term declines in mid-cap stocks. The ETF is highly volatile and not designed for long-term investment. Due to compounding, returns should not be expected to inversely mirror the index over longer time periods, and its high expense ratio can eat into returns if held for too long.

The fund invests in financial instruments that the advisor believes, in combination, should produce daily returns consistent with the Daily Target. The index is a measure of mid-size company U.S. stock market performance. It is a market capitalization-weighted index of 400 U.S. operating companies and real estate investment trusts selected through a process that factors in criteria such as liquidity, price, market capitalization, financial viability and public float. It is non-diversified.
